Bio Vocab 2 - Scientific Investigation

Term
Definition
variable   anything that can affect an experiment or outcome  
🗑
one   number of varibles that can be tested at a time  
🗑
scientific method   steps to answer a scientific question  
🗑
independent variable   the variable changed by the experimentor to observe the results  
🗑
dependent variable   the variable that is measured  
🗑
control group   group that is not tested ,but used only to compare.  
🗑
experimental group   the group that is tested/experimented on  
🗑
quantitative   data is numerical, like time, number of, or mass.  
🗑
hypothesis   guess or prediction  
🗑
experiment   process used to test hypothesis  
🗑
theory   an idea with that has a lot of data to support it, but its not a proven fact.  
🗑
law   a statement based on repeated experimental observations, observed in nature  
🗑
qualitative   data describing the quality , like appearance, color, or movement, or smell  
🗑
experimental error   weakens a scientific study, can be due to inaccurate measurements, faulty tools, improper set up  
🗑
model   tools for representing ideas and explanations, can be diagrams, drawings, physical replicas, mathematical representations, or simulations.  
🗑
phenomenom   a fact or situation that is observed to exist or happen, especially one whose cause or explanation is in question.
